## Formula sandbox tuning

User-supplied formulas in Gridmoor execute inside a restricted interpreter with hard ceilings on time, memory, and call depth. Reviewers should confirm any change to these ceilings is justified in the PR description, since raising them widens the abuse surface. Defaults were chosen from production traces. The current limits are as follows.

limits module of tafog-fawip:
WEIGHTS = {
    "julix": 57,
    "lamys": 992,
    "kasvan": 209,
    "quenok": 750,
    "alddor": 259,
    "oliath": 1009,
    "wenix": 815,
}

Ticket RB-2241: Sort instability in Gridform report builder.

Steps: 1) Open any report with duplicate values in the primary sort column. 2) Sort ascending, then descending, then ascending again. 3) Rows with equal keys reorder randomly each pass.

Expected: stable order. Blocks the 4.2 release. Verify via the export API using the token below.

session JWT of yawep-yawep = eyJhbGciOiJIUzI1NiIsInR5cCI6IkpXVCJ9.eyJzdWIiOiI3pWF3_In0.aXYsHiog

Key ceremony checklist — item 12 (Pellamy Seat-Map Renderer). Before sealing the signing key for the theatre seat-map renderer, confirm that the rehearsal render completed without layout drift and that both support witnesses have initialed the ceremony log. Support staff should note that any future emergency unseal requires two people and the documented phrase; never perform an unseal alone or off the record. When the ceremony lead calls for it, read out the recovery passphrase recorded directly beneath this item.

strongbox words: zoreth-fraox-oliius-aldeth-jorax-praeth-holmir-drumir-prawyn

- [ ] Step 7: Archive cold storage buckets (Glacierline tier). Confirm both ceremony witnesses are present, verify bucket manifests match the Oxbow ledger, then seal the archive key shares. Plugin authors may observe but not handle shares. Once sealed, the archive index itself is encrypted and can only be reopened with the passphrase below.

vault phrase of badup-hahig = tamael-aldael-kelmir-istael-fenok-istwyn-tamius-jorath-oliion